Tim Laudner played in 7 games at first base for the Minnesota Twins in 1987, starting in 3 of them. He played for a total of 93 outs, equivalent to 3.44 9-inning games.

He made 30 putouts, had one assist, and committed no errors, equivalent to 0 errors per 9-inning game. He had 3 double plays.

What were the fielding stats for baseball player Tim Laudner playing at catcher for the Minnesota Twins in 1988?

Tim Laudner played in 109 games at catcher for the Minnesota Twins in 1988, starting in 102 of them. He played for a total of 2678 outs, equivalent to 99.19 9-inning games. He made 621 putouts, had 35 assists, and committed 5 errors, equivalent to .05 errors per 9-inning game. He had 8 double plays. He had 8 passed balls, 37 wild pitches, 76 opponent stolen bases, and 25 opponent caught stealings. His zone rating was 3.

When and where did baseball player Tim Laudner play?

Tim Laudner debuted on August 28, 1981, playing for the Minnesota Twins at Metropolitan Stadium; he played his final game on September 3, 1989, playing for the Minnesota Twins at Hubert H Humphrey Metrodome.

What were the fielding stats for baseball player Tim Laudner playing at catcher for the Minnesota Twins in 1987?

Tim Laudner played in 101 games at catcher for the Minnesota Twins in 1987, starting in 76 of them. He played for a total of 2106 outs, equivalent to 78 9-inning games. He made 517 putouts, had 28 assists, and committed 7 errors, equivalent to .09 errors per 9-inning game. He had 2 double plays. He had 10 passed balls, 28 wild pitches, 66 opponent stolen bases, and 21 opponent caught stealings.
